GAINESVILLE, Fla. – The Oklahoma baseball team fell to No. 13 seed Florida 7-2 Sunday evening at Condron Family Ballpark, setting up a deciding game seven in the NCAA Gainesville Regional.
The Sooners (39-21) and Gators (42-23) will meet again at noon CT Monday.
Peyton Graham lined a one-out single in the sixth inning for OU's first hit of the game and later scored on a base hit by
Tanner Tredaway after
Blake Robertson doubled.
Jimmy Crooks brought home Robertson with a single to right field to tie the game, 2-2. Crooks went 2 for 4 in the ballgame.
Florida took the lead again in the top of the seventh on a single by BT Riopelle and made the score 4-2 in the eighth on a solo home run by Jud Fabian. A wild pitch, a sacrifice fly and an error scored three more runs in the eighth to make it 7-2. Fabian homered in the fourth inning and Jac Caglianone singled in a run in the fifth to give the Gators a 2-0 lead.
Cade Horton turned in his longest outing of the season, pitching 6.1 innings. He struck out eight batters and allowed two runs on seven hits.
Carson Atwood (2-4) took the loss for OU. Florida's Carsten Finnvold (2-1) entered the game in relief with the bases loaded and no outs in the first inning, and went the distance, allowing two runs on five hits.
